On Wednesday, December 16th:

Tyler Mitchell, Executive Director of the Open Source Geospatial
Foundation(OSGeo) will be visiting Davis (and author of "Web Mapping
Illustrated", O'Reilly Media 2005). The foundation is the central
organization for many free and open source software projects related to
geospatial: Quantum GIS, PostGIS, Mapserver, Geoserver, OpenLayers, GDAL...
http://www.osgeo.org

We will be hosting a short talk/discussion
4pm in 2120J Wickson Hall, UC Davis

Followed by an extended meet & greet
5:15pm at Delta of Venus (Guaranteed till 6:15pm)
